Frederic Chopin was alone among the great composers in that he made his living almost entirely from teaching piano.
During the period around the 1840’s he was the most famous piano teacher in Paris, largely because he was also one of the most famous and beloved composers in the world.
His roster of students contained many great and good pianists, among them Mikuli, who became the editor of Chopin’s printed piano music.
Chopin taught at home in a lavish, well appointed studio. It contained two pianos: one beautiful Erard grand, on which the student played, and a small cottage upright, at which the master sat and demonstrated.
